How do you freeze your car insurance?

I’m about to go abroad for a semester. I want to freeze my car insurance since I won't be driving my car for a few months. How can I freeze my insurance?

avatar
Will Baldwin · Updated on
Reviewed by Shannon Martin, Licensed Insurance Agent.
A semester abroad sounds amazing! To freeze your
car insurance
, you’re going to have to contact your insurance company, either in person or via the phone. Not all companies let customers pause their coverage, so it may not be possible.
If your car insurance provider doesn’t allow freezing, you have two options.
One is to
cancel your car insurance
while you’re away. The negative here is you will have a coverage gap.
The other is maintaining the
minimum amount of car insurance
required in your state or keeping
storage only insurance
. These would eliminate the possibility of the gap, lessen your headache about suspending, and be probably the easiest to do. The downside is you’d still have to pay your insurance while away.
